Crayon Drawings

One of my favorite mediums is NeoColor 1 wax/oil crayon.  They are, basically, very high quality color crayons…….like the Crayola crayons we all grew up with, except artist grade with a high concentration of pigment. They can be layered and blended, scraped away, polished to a high sheen.  I work most of the time on Canson vellum bristol, but they will mark on anything….paper, wood, metal, glass. They can also be used in conjunction with Prismacolor pencils.

They are excellent for bring along when I travel…..way less messy than paint.
